    I'm not overlooking anything he's done, I've watched him live every step of the way and I've never seen a goalie who should have been in the conversation for the 1st round of last years draft.

    I can't show you a Jr goalie who doesn't have a long way to go because there's no such thing but what I can show you are jr goalies with elite SV% and Fucale is not one of them. His win/loss record and GAA average shade the fact that he's an above average Jr goalie, nothing more. Put Bibeau on the Moose last year and he'd have been drafted 3 or 4 rounds higher.

    The Moose won last year by completely dominating the puck possession game and pounding a ridiculous number of pucks into the net, I'd say it had little to do with their goaltending and even less to do with their defence. Their offence was one of the best the CHL has seen in quite some time, they scored 24 goals in 5 Mem cup games!! Here's a look at the QMJHL bracket: http://theqmjhl.ca/standings/playoff...son/172http:// they ran over most of the teams they played. Now I know that you know all of this but I find it interesting that we're both watching the same team regularly and coming away with such different impressions. I'm certainly no scout but I'm not alone among Moose fans I've met at the games in thinking Fucale has ridden to prominence on the back of an amazing team. If he was on some middling CHL team most people would still have never heard of him.

    For the record, I'm not dumping on the kid as much as pointing out that I think he's overrated. It's not his fault that people are valuing him like a future NHL starter based on the Mooseheads hype and draft position
